Naveen Patnaik participates in ongoing Jansampark Padayatra
Addressing a public meeting at the Patharbandh slum near Satsang Vihar on the eighth day of the BJD`s 10-day public relations campaign, Patnaik said that although the Central Government has a big role to play for development of the State, it has not shown any interest for it in last six years since it came to power.
Coming down heavily on the Centre`s stepmotherly attitude, he said, "The Centre is only shedding crocodile tears when it comes to saving the State against natural disasters like flood, drought and cyclone or promoting its interests. When it releases huge sums to other States at the time of natural calamities, it gives very negligible assistance to Odisha even if it faces disasters of greater dimensions."
Apart from the Chief Minister, MP Dr Prasanna Patsani , BJD MLAs Bhagirathi Badjena, Ashok Chandra Panda, Bijay Kumar Mohanty, Mayor Anant Narayan Jena and also graced the occasion among others.
During the padyatra, the ruling party members mobilized public opinion against the continuous negligence shown towards the state by the UPA government and highlighted the BJD government`s achievements.
